What To Do If You Find A Tick On Your Dog

Ticks are found in Alberta on tall grasses particularly in the spring time. Ticks can transfer on to dogs and people as they brush through the long grass. Ticks are parasites that feed off of the blood of pets & humans. There are two main types of ticks: hard ticks…

My dog has worms what do I do?

If you are seeing long ‘spaghetti’ type worms passed in your dog’s feces then the best thing to do is bring a fecal sample to our St. Albert office for analysis and confirm the type of worm that they are. Your dog may also require a complete physical examination by…
